How Much Does a Bookkeeper Charge?

The fees charged by bookkeepers can vary depending on several factors. Generally, bookkeepers charge an hourly rate or a flat fee for specific services. Hourly rates often range from $20 to $50 per hour, while flat fees can vary based on the complexity and volume of the work involved. Factors influencing the rate include the bookkeeper’s experience, qualifications, geographic location, and the size of the business they are assisting. Specialized industries or more intricate financial records might lead to higher charges. For small businesses, hiring a freelance bookkeeper can be more cost-effective than employing a full-time professional. However, outsourcing to a bookkeeping firm might incur higher costs due to additional overheads. To obtain an accurate estimate, it’s advisable to request quotes from multiple bookkeepers and compare their services. Choosing the right bookkeeper should be based not only on price but also on their expertise and reliability. Prioritizing quality bookkeeping is crucial for maintaining financial accuracy and facilitating business growth.
